Ordinals
testnet4
Sat 1689565743669128
decimal
511652.743669128
degree
0°91652′1604″743669128‴
percentile
80.4555116917929%
name
bwokbhtkblp
cycle
0
epoch
2
period
253
block
511652
offset
743669128
timestamp
2033-07-22 17:42:29 UTC
(expected)
rarity
common
prev
next